Sodium valproate monotherapy in childhood epilepsy
Brain & Development
|January 1, 1986
Summary
Valproate monotherapy effectively controlled various epilepsies in children, with absence and benign myoclonic types showing best responses. Discontinuation led to relapse in some generalized tonic-clonic epilepsy cases but not others.
Area of Science:
- Pediatric Neurology
- Clinical Pharmacology
Background:
- Valproate is a common antiepileptic drug used in children.
- Understanding its efficacy and safety in monotherapy is crucial for treatment optimization.
Purpose of the Study:
- To evaluate the efficacy and tolerability of valproate monotherapy in pediatric epilepsy.
- To assess seizure recurrence after valproate discontinuation in different epilepsy types.
Main Methods:
- Prospective follow-up of 154 pediatric patients on valproate monotherapy for 5-27 months.
- Analysis of seizure control, adverse effects, and relapse rates after treatment cessation.
Main Results:
- Valproate monotherapy showed good control for absence epilepsies, benign myoclonic epilepsies, and epilepsies with tonic-clonic seizures on awakening.
- Improvement was noted in 13/14 patients with primary generalized epilepsy on monotherapy.
- Mild to moderate adverse effects occurred in 16% of patients.
- No relapse was observed in absence, benign myoclonic, infantile spasms, or benign partial epilepsy after discontinuation.
- Two-thirds of patients with generalized tonic-clonic seizures on awakening relapsed post-cessation.
Conclusions:
- Valproate monotherapy is effective for several pediatric epilepsy syndromes, particularly absence and benign myoclonic types.
- While generally well-tolerated, careful consideration of discontinuation is needed for generalized tonic-clonic seizures on awakening due to relapse risk.
